description
The ALS857 are hextuple 2-line to 1-line multiplexers with 3-state outputs. The devices can provide either true (COMP low) or inverted (COMP high) data at the Y outputs. In addition, the ALS857 perform the logical AND function (A · B) and the clear function as well. The four modes of operation are:

Select A-data inputs Select B-data inputs AND A inputs with B inputs Clear
In either of the first two modes, OPER = 0 is high if all the selected A or B inputs are low. The six Y outputs and the OPER = 0 output are all 3-state and rated at 12-mA and 24-mA IOL for the SN54ALS857 and SN74ALS857, respectively. All outputs can be placed in the high-impedance state by applying a high level to the COMP, S0, and S1 inputs simultaneously.

The SN54ALS857 is characterized for operation over the full military temperature range of 55°C to 125°C. The SN74ALS857 is characterized for operation from 0°C to 70°C.
